China, Argentina discover common passion for tango

China Daily | Updated: 2017-05-06 07:14

China and Argentina are finding new common ground in a joint love for tango, the seductive and confrontational Argentinean dance that is finding new fertile ground in China. Xinhua spent some time in Argentina with a Sino-Argentinean couple, Shelly Hou and Juan Berthier, who have begun gathering students in Buenos Aires.

In the city's Salon Canning, the two dancers put on a "milonga," a space where tango lovers come to dance and give free rein to their passion.

Hou, born in Shanghai, told Xinhua that her passion for tango began when she saw it performed on television. "After that, I took a holiday to Buenos Aires and moved here in 2013 to learn Spanish and tango," she said.
